合う(あう)
JLPT N4 · Godan verb (Group 1)
Pitch accent: atamadaka (head-high) — first mora high, then falls
Meaning: to fit / match
Conjugation
| Form | Japanese | Reading |
|---|---|---|
| masu-form (polite) | 合います | あいます |
| te-form | 合って | あって |
| ta-form (past) | 合った | あった |
| nai-form (negative) | 合わない | あわない |
| potential form | 合える | あえる |

Example sentences
- このネクタイはスーツによく合う。 — This tie goes really well with the suit.
- 意見が合わなかったので、よく話し合った。 — Since our opinions didn't match, we talked it over thoroughly.
Idioms & proverbs containing “合う”
- 袖振り合うも他生の縁 (そでふりあうもたしょうのえん) — even a chance meeting can lead to a deep bond; even a chance meeting is due to the karma of a previous life
- 袖すり合うも多生の縁 (そですりあうもたしょうのえん) — a meeting by chance is preordained
- 合うも不思議、合わぬも不思議 (あうもふしぎ、あわぬもふしぎ) — dreams and fortune-telling are hit-and-miss
- 肌が合う (はだがあう) — to be compatible; to get along well
- 息が合う (いきがあう) — to perform in tune with each other; to get along well; to be in perfect harmony; to make a perfect pair (team, etc.)
- 肌に合う (はだにあう) — to suit one's skin (of cosmetics); to agree with one's skin
